The Imperative of Trust in the Digital Gambling Ecosystem
Unlike traditional brick-and-mortar casinos, online operators face the unique challenge of establishing trust without physical presence. This trust hinges on several factors:
- Licensing and Regulation: Is the operator licensed by reputable authorities such as the UK Gambling Commission?
- Fair Gameplay Enforcement: Are the random number generators (RNGs) and payout processes verified and transparent?
- User Feedback and Reputation: What are players saying about their experiences, especially regarding withdrawals and customer support?
In this context, independent review platforms and user-centric feedback mechanisms serve as critical barometers for credibility. They provide aggregated, real-world data that can influence both consumer choice and regulatory oversight.

Data-Driven Insights: Industry Standards and Best Practices
To contextualize user feedback, industry analysts maintain dashboards that aggregate review data, payout statistics, and licensing information. According to recent reports by the UK Gambling Commission, licensed operators adhere to stringent standards regarding fairness and player protection.
For example, the table below delineates key criteria used to evaluate online casino credibility:
| Criterion | Importance | Industry Benchmark |
|---|---|---|
| Licensing & Regulation | Critical | UK Gambling Commission, MGA |
| Fairness & RNG Certification | High | ECOGRA, iTech Labs |
| User Feedback & Reputation | Vital | Aggregated reviews, Trustpilot scores |
| Transparency & Payout Speed | High | Verified via reviews and audits |
By integrating these standards with real-world user reviews, stakeholders—including players, regulators, and operators themselves—can promote a safer, more transparent online gambling environment.
